|
@@ -41,7 +41,7 @@
|
|
{
|
|
{
|
|
// Check position if it is relevant to you
|
|
// Check position if it is relevant to you
|
|
// Otherwise, just check data
|
|
// Otherwise, just check data
|
|
- return data.VariantType == Variant.Type.Dictionary && data.AsGodotDictionary().Contains("expected");
|
|
|
|
|
|
+ return data.VariantType == Variant.Type.Dictionary && data.AsGodotDictionary().ContainsKey("expected");
|
|
}
|
|
}
|
|
[/csharp]
|
|
[/csharp]
|
|
[/codeblocks]
|
|
[/codeblocks]
|
|
@@ -64,7 +64,7 @@
|
|
[csharp]
|
|
[csharp]
|
|
public override bool _CanDropData(Vector2 atPosition, Variant data)
|
|
public override bool _CanDropData(Vector2 atPosition, Variant data)
|
|
{
|
|
{
|
|
- return data.VariantType == Variant.Type.Dictionary && dict.AsGodotDictionary().Contains("color");
|
|
|
|
|
|
+ return data.VariantType == Variant.Type.Dictionary && dict.AsGodotDictionary().ContainsKey("color");
|
|
}
|
|
}
|
|
|
|
|
|
public override void _DropData(Vector2 atPosition, Variant data)
|
|
public override void _DropData(Vector2 atPosition, Variant data)
|